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
211 3831848441 5875487498 51904902520 85282
32 189569
32 189569
028 49405996 892 366
All about undefined
Interested in learning more?
32 189569
028 49405996 892 366
See more
03657312081 536
86698 824026 236221
See more
7038257 334076213
210121459 882697 91
See more